§ 22-3-2105 — Applicability

Arkansas·Title 22
(a)A petition for a waiver may be authorized under § 22-3-2104(b) if the application of this subchapter interferes with the construction, maintenance, or operation of a public facility owned or managed by the Department of Parks, Heritage, and Tourism.
(b)A court of competent jurisdiction may enjoin any violation of or noncompliance with the provisions of this subchapter upon petition by a resident of the State of Arkansas or by the Arkansas History Commission.
(c)(1) A historical monument in existence on April 28, 2021, is considered a historical monument for the purposes of this subchapter.
(2)A historical monument not currently displayed by a public entity is considered a historical monument for the purposes of this subchapter.
